520 _aThis research outlines the development and deployment of an Information Retrieval System (IRS) of Academic Papers with Automatic Tagging using Text Network Analysis at the Technological University of the Philippines, Manila Campus, aimed at facilitating access to Academic Papers. The primary goal is to improve the ease with which students and faculty can discover and utilize relevant academic research. The system was developed in Visual Studio Code using React JS, HTML, CSS, and Tailwind CSS for the front-end and Laravel for backend. PHP and SQL for database management. Figma for the design of the wireframe and GitHub for the version control. A comprehensive evaluation involving 30 participants, equally divided between Non-IT and Professional IT, was conducted following the ISO 25010 for Software Quality Standards. The results show an overall score of 3.65, which falls into the “Highly Acceptable” category. It is by the standard of ISO 25010 for Software Quality Standards. Participants conveyed positive perceptions about the system's functional suitability and expressed satisfaction with its overall performance and user interface. This study validates the effective application of the Information Retrieval System with the Automatic Tagging system at the Technological University of the Philippines, Manila Campus. It highlights the system's potential for assisting students. Students are able to benefit greatly by having access to previous Academic Papers that are relevant for their courses. It depicts, in a concrete way, the structure as well as the functionality and the user interface of an Information Retrieval System educationally.
